Output 853e8fa21453fe040196818639317ee2dac5ed5248f768feff3148a0f3a79a17:1

value
26322240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fab763406daac3d2150deec1c1fdcc3ee211b821 OP_EQUAL
address
3QYgYW5sgPKmovjh6JRmqdWzhebLKMJJxW
transaction
853e8fa21453fe040196818639317ee2dac5ed5248f768feff3148a0f3a79a17